Regulatory News: Sodexo (Paris:SW) (OTCBB:SDXAY), a world leader in Food and Facilities
Management services, announced today that it has signed an agreement to
acquire a majority interest in West Born, a specialist in providing
concierge services to corporate clients in France. West Born offers
clients innovative, attractive solutions in concierge services, employee
motivation and employee loyalty programs. This acquisition reinforces Sodexo´s expertise
in services which improve the Quality of Life and will provide important
synergies with all Sodexo client segments in France, in both the Food
and Facilities Management services and the Service Vouchers and Cards
activities. Expertise also will be exchanged with Circles, a leader in
concierge services in North America acquired by Sodexo in 2007. West Born was founded in 2005 in Paris by Xavier Chouraqui-Servière
who will continue as CEO of the company. SODEXO, founded in 1966 by Pierre Bellon, is a world leader in Food
